My clients are frequently asked…’so how have you done it’…when their friends see the amazing results they’ve achieved.

Their answer is very straight forward, they simply stuck to the plan, to which their friends reply…’oh, I wish I had your will power!’

This is a common miss-conception; that you need the will power of a warrior to make serious changes to your body…WRONG!

The difference between those who achieve their goals and those who don’t is down to one simple factor…they have the right MINDSET. You see, you could be given the best diet, training and supplement plan, but if your head isn’t in the ‘right place’ it’s completely pointless.

One technique, I use all the time myself, to help me stay ‘on the wagon’, is Positive Self Talk. This is the little voice inside your head that tells you that you CAN do it, rather than you can’t. For example, at the point when your workout is getting super hard and you have 30 seconds of squats left to go but you feel like giving in-then you use positive self talk, and tell yourself ‘c’mon you CAN do it’!

For me, self talk very often boils down to one question… ’Will this take me further to my goal or further away?’

For example, you have an outdoor training session at 6.15am, you wake up at 5.45am and can hear the rain on the window, its cold outside, you’re tired, and you think to yourself, ‘oh, I’ll just give it a miss today, I’ll definitely train tomorrow. It’s at this point you should be asking yourself, will this decision take me closer to or further away from my goal?

Another great question to ask yourself at times of weakness is…’how will I feel if I don’t achieve my goal?’

For example, if your goal is that in 28 days time, for your friend’s wedding, you want to get into the new dress you bought that you can’t quite zip up and have it fit comfortably, but you’re offered a slice of birthday cake at your cousin’s birthday party, just ask yourself how you will feel if in 28 days time you put the dress on and you can’t zip it up!

With the above examples in mind, I would encourage you to, as me and all my clients do, every time you’re faced with a decision that could affect you achieving goal, ask yourself…

WILL THIS TAKE ME CLOSER TO MY GOAL, OR FURTHER AWAY?

And…

HOW WILL I FEEL IF I DONT ACHIEVE MY GOAL?

Let’s make 2011 the year you GET the body you really want, rather than watching other people achieve it instead!

I used my weekly ‘cheat meal’ at the cinema and had nachos and salsa, and it got me thinking…could I come up with a ‘clean’ alternative???

So I had a go and made my own homemade salsa…oh and its lush with rice cakes!

Salsa

Recipe (serves 4 people)
1/2 tin of chopped tomatos
2 tbl sp tomato puree
1 tsp of grated apple
1 handful of chopped spinach
sprinkle of sea salt
sprinkle of black pepper
sprinkle of chilli powder
sprinkle of thyme

The just stir it all up!

So here we are about to embark on a brand new year, maybe even starting to think about our new year resolutions, and with Wikipedia ranking improved health and weight loss as the most popular resolutions, it’s no surprise that gyms and health club chains experience their highest volume of sales in January.

Just picture the scene…

The festive period has come to an end and you feel fat, bloated and generally grey, yet fired up to make some dramatic changes to how you look in the mirror!

As if by magic your local gym knows this, and in fairy godmother style, has sent you a mail shot offering you January free when you sign up or a free pass for your pal if you join in the next 7 days.

Such deals excite you! The gym talks of shedding your Christmas flab using its many facilities… and you’re hooked. Its promise of a new body for a New Year fills you with confidence that these results will become reality…you will look like the air brushed gym bunny on the leaflet just by breathing health club air!

So you bite their hand off! You and your bags of motivation make great plans and commitments; you attend the gym every morning during your first week back to work and pound the treadmill with a true determination and fire in your belly…you have a clear goal…you will have a better body this time next year!

This passionate adherence continues for a few weeks until one of two things happen…

1. One morning you miss your alarm and sleep in or you’re tired after work and decide to ‘give it a miss just this once’. This ‘just once’ leads to ‘just twice’ and before you know it, ‘oops, you’ve missed a week!’ WHY? Because you are only accountable to yourself, the gym didn’t make an appointment with you, the group fitness class didn’t get cancelled ‘cos you weren’t there!

OR…

2. You dug out the dress you’d pictured yourself fitting back into as you sweated your balls of in the gym (yes I realise that generally those with balls don’t usually wear dresses), and to your disappointment, it nowhere near fits! In short, you didn’t get the results you wanted, you don’t look like the air brushed gym bunny on the leaflet and you ask yourself ‘why am I busting my balls for nothing’, lose your motivation and hardly go back. You lose and the gym wins the best kind of member; one who pays and doesn’t go!

So where did it all go wrong?

• The gym offers no accountability, no support and little encouragement. We are only human after all; we need motivation, love and support!

The Solution: Ditch the gym (they probably won’t notice if you gain 10 stone, poo a pound, do 50 classes a week or do one a fortnight), instead opt for a class, personal trainer, or course of sessions like a boot camp! All of these gym alternatives offer the support of either a trainer or fellow participants, all of which you actively make yourself accountable to, e.g. ‘Oh I said I’d meet Katie at class, I can’t drop her in it’ or ‘My trainer is going to be measuring me next week, I better get my ass to the gym’, and all are there to motivate you!

• There was no realistic, time related goal!
The Solution: Set a goal that is super specific and realistic and has a definitive date, and this can work for any area of your life, e.g. By January 30th 2011, I will have lost 5cms from my waist.

So you’ve read this and already started thinking about what your goal might be (hopefully), and may have contemplated one of the gym alternatives I mentioned earlier, but how do you know you’re making the right choice, and how do you spot a good gym alternative from a bad one?

A good trainer will:
• Have testimonials with before and after pictures of previous clients
• Ask you lots of questions about yourself and not spend your first meeting telling you about how they’ve done this course and that course and are the highest qualified PT ever! (Of course they should be properly qualified and insured but the clue is in the title…PERSONAL training)
• Constantly update their knowledge and your programs

A good class/class instructor will:
• Regularly change their class content and offer modifications where necessary to meet the needs of their class
• Take an interest in you, even if that just means remembering your name out of a class of 40 people
• Be able to tell you the benefits and the why’s
• Admit if they don’t know the answer to something instead of bullshitting you. Instead they’ll go off and find the answer for you for next time
• Keep updating their knowledge as well as updating you on new classes etc

A good course or boot camp should be an awesome mix of all of the above!

I hope you’ve found this article helpful, and have pointed you in the best direction to help YOU achieve your 2011 goals!
